About The Position

The Front of House Manager plays a key leadership role in the daily operations of the restaurant. This position helps lead the service team, supports the development of staff, and ensures that every guest experience reflects Hai Hospitality’s standards of thoughtful, genuine hospitality. Our managers work closely with the General Manager and Assistant General Manager to maintain service excellence, support team growth, and uphold the culture of the restaurant.
